Saint Ignatius of Loyola Sculpture Description

The Saint Ignatius of Loyola sculpture often serves as a decorative focal point in Jesuit institutions, such as schools, universities, and churches. The sculpture is typically placed in prominent locations where it can be easily seen by students, faculty, visitors, and worshippers. The presence of the Saint Ignatius of Loyola sculpture is not merely ornamental but serves as a daily reminder of the Jesuit ethos of “finding God in all things.” The art captures the spirit of Ignatius’s spiritual insights, including his emphasis on education, reflective practice, and service to others.

In terms of artistic style, the sculpture of Saint Ignatius can vary widely, from classical and realistic to modern and abstract interpretations. These stylistic choices contribute to the decorative impact of the sculpture within its space. A more traditional sculpture might inspire reverence and a sense of historical continuity, while a contemporary interpretation could invite reflection and dialogue about the ongoing relevance of Ignatian spirituality in today’s world. Saint Ignatius of Loyola is sitting on a chair, carefully reading a book. The decorative elements of a Saint Ignatius sculpture often encapsulate symbols associated with his life and teachings.
